10 Educational Apps to Teach Kids About Technology: In a world increasingly driven by technology, equipping our children with digital literacy skills is no longer a luxury, but a necessity. This exploration delves into ten fantastic educational apps designed to make learning about technology fun, engaging, and accessible for young minds. We’ll uncover how these apps bridge the gap between traditional learning and the digital age, fostering a generation comfortable and confident in navigating the ever-evolving tech landscape.
Prepare to discover a treasure trove of resources that will empower your children to become tech-savvy individuals.
From coding adventures to interactive simulations, these apps offer a diverse range of learning methods tailored to different age groups and learning styles. We’ll examine their unique features, pedagogical approaches, and the ways they contribute to a child’s overall technological development. We’ll also address crucial aspects like parental controls, safety features, cost, and accessibility, ensuring you have all the information needed to make informed choices for your child’s digital journey.
Let’s embark on this exciting exploration together!
Educational Apps and Tech Literacy for Kids: 10 Educational Apps To Teach Kids About Technology
Educational apps are software applications designed to enhance learning, specifically tailored for children to understand and interact with technology. They bridge the gap between traditional learning and the digital world, offering engaging and interactive ways to grasp technological concepts. Early exposure to technology is crucial for future success, as it equips children with essential skills needed to thrive in an increasingly digital society.
Educational apps provide a significant advantage over traditional methods, offering personalized learning experiences, immediate feedback, and access to a vast array of resources that cater to diverse learning styles.
Top 10 Educational Apps: A Detailed Overview
The following table lists ten educational apps categorized by their focus and suitability for different age groups. Each app offers a unique approach to teaching technology, fostering different skills and catering to varied learning preferences. The key features highlighted emphasize the core functionalities that contribute to the effectiveness of each app in teaching children about technology.
App Name | App Description | Age Range | Key Features |
---|---|---|---|
CodeSpark Academy | Teaches coding through playful games and challenges. | 5-10 | Visual programming, puzzles, interactive stories |
Tynker | Introduces coding concepts using block-based programming and game creation. | 7-13 | Block-based coding, game design, interactive tutorials |
ScratchJr | Simplified visual programming language for younger children. | 5-7 | Drag-and-drop programming, story creation, animation |
Blockly Games | Introduces programming logic through fun and engaging games. | 8-12 | Puzzle-based learning, gradual increase in complexity, visual feedback |
Kodable | Teaches coding fundamentals using a friendly maze-based game. | 4-10 | Game-based learning, step-by-step tutorials, visual programming |
Lightbot | Teaches sequencing and logic through programming a robot. | 4-14 | Puzzle-solving, programming concepts, visual programming |
Cargo-Bot | Introduces programming concepts through a puzzle game involving robots and crates. | 8+ | Puzzle-solving, programming logic, strategic thinking |
Move the Turtle | Uses a simple interface to teach basic programming concepts. | 6-9 | Simple commands, visual feedback, step-by-step instructions |
Daisy the Dinosaur | Introduces basic programming concepts in a fun and engaging way. | 4-7 | Simple commands, animation, interactive storytelling |
Minecraft: Education Edition | A platform for creative learning and collaboration using block-based coding. | 8+ | World building, coding, collaboration, problem-solving |
App Functionality and Learning Methods Employed
These apps employ a variety of learning methods, primarily leveraging gamification and interactive simulations to engage children. Gamification makes learning fun and motivating through points, rewards, and challenges. Interactive simulations allow children to experiment and learn from their mistakes in a safe environment. Storytelling is also used to make complex concepts more relatable and easier to understand. Each app incorporates various aspects of technology, including coding, digital citizenship, and online safety, tailored to the age group and learning objectives.
For example, CodeSpark Academy uses visual programming and interactive stories to teach coding concepts, while Minecraft: Education Edition combines world-building with coding to promote creativity and problem-solving skills. Apps like Blockly Games use puzzle-based learning to gradually introduce programming logic, providing visual feedback to reinforce learning.
Curriculum Alignment and Educational Value
Many of these apps align with various educational standards focusing on computational thinking, problem-solving, and digital literacy. They contribute to the development of specific technological skills, including coding, debugging, algorithmic thinking, and creative problem-solving. The apps can be categorized based on their contribution to different areas of technology education, such as programming (CodeSpark Academy, Tynker), digital literacy (many of the apps cover this implicitly through responsible online behavior), and even basic hardware understanding (through simulations of simple machines or electronics).
App Design and User Experience, 10 Educational Apps to Teach Kids About Technology
The user interface and user experience (UI/UX) design varies significantly across these apps. Generally, they prioritize simplicity and intuitiveness, using bright colors, engaging animations, and clear instructions. Successful apps like CodeSpark Academy use a playful design that keeps children engaged, while apps that are too complex or cluttered can hinder the learning experience. Effective design choices include clear visual cues, intuitive navigation, and immediate feedback, while ineffective choices can include confusing layouts, overwhelming information, or lack of clear instructions.
Parental Controls and Safety Features
Many of these apps include parental controls and safety features to ensure a safe and positive learning environment. These features often include age-appropriate content filtering, time limits, and privacy settings. The importance of these features cannot be overstated, as they protect children from inappropriate content and online risks. The approach to safety and privacy varies; some apps offer more comprehensive controls than others.
Parents should carefully review the privacy policies and safety features before allowing their children to use any educational app.
Cost and Accessibility
The pricing models of these apps vary, with some offering free versions with limited features, while others require subscriptions or one-time purchases for full access. Accessibility features, such as language support and accessibility for children with disabilities, also vary. A balanced assessment considers both cost and accessibility to determine the best fit for each child’s needs and family circumstances.
- CodeSpark Academy: Subscription model; offers some free content. Accessibility features vary depending on device capabilities.
- Tynker: Freemium model; offers a limited free version and paid subscriptions for full access. Accessibility features are generally good.
- ScratchJr: Free; open-source. Accessibility features are generally good.
Illustrative Examples: App Functionality Demonstrations
Let’s consider CodeSpark Academy. The app’s main screen presents a vibrant, cartoon-like world with various interactive elements. Children can choose from different game levels, each introducing a new coding concept. A typical level might involve guiding a character through a maze by dragging and dropping code blocks, such as “move forward,” “turn left,” and “jump.” The visual feedback, such as the character’s movements and animations, reinforces the coding commands.
The success or failure of each command is immediately visible, allowing children to learn from their mistakes and refine their coding skills. This process of trial and error, coupled with positive reinforcement, makes learning fun and engaging. Similarly, other apps use different interactive elements and visual cues to effectively teach technology concepts. For instance, Blockly Games utilizes colorful blocks and animated feedback to help children grasp programming logic.
The intuitive design and immediate feedback are crucial in fostering a positive learning experience and promoting active participation.
Equipping children with technological literacy is a crucial investment in their future. The ten educational apps highlighted in this guide offer a diverse and engaging approach to learning, catering to various age groups and learning styles. By leveraging gamification, interactive simulations, and storytelling, these apps transform learning about technology into a fun and rewarding experience. Remember to consider factors such as parental controls, safety features, cost, and accessibility when selecting an app.
Empower your children to confidently navigate the digital world – one app at a time!